Why a Kubota V2203 Engine Bearing Set Rebuild Fails Before First Start

The bearing grade must match the crankshaft journal diameter left by the last regrind, not the factory standard.

When a repair shop tears down a Kubota V-series engine, the crankshaft journals often show witness marks of a previous regrind to 0.25 or 0.50 undersize. Installing standard-size main and connecting rod bearings onto a reground journal creates excessive oil clearance, causing low oil pressure at idle and rapid bearing knock within the first operating hours [NEED_CITE: engine bearing oil clearance tolerances and failure modes]. A Kubota V2203 engine bearing set rebuild succeeds only when the shop verifies the actual journal dimensions with a micrometer before the new bearing set is ordered, preventing a second teardown that costs more in labour than the parts themselves.

System Context for V-Series Bottom-End Overhauls

The main and connecting rod bearings in Kubota V1903 through V2403 engines operate within a pressurised lubrication circuit that feeds oil through drilled passages in the crankshaft. These bearings carry both radial loads from combustion pressure and axial loads managed by the thrust washer. A complete Kubota V2203 engine bearing set rebuild addresses all three wear surfaces simultaneously, ensuring the matched tolerances across the rotating assembly prevent uneven load distribution that would otherwise accelerate wear on the newest component.

Crankshaft Condition and Undersize Selection

Every crankshaft removed from a field-operated Kubota engine carries a history. Previous regrinds, heat discolouration from oil starvation events, and journal taper all affect which bearing grade fits correctly. The thrust washer controls crankshaft end-play, and its thickness must correspond to the thrust face condition [NEED_CITE: crankshaft end-play measurement standards for diesel engines]. Shops that skip the micrometer check and order standard bearings by default often discover the mismatch only after assembly, when plastigauge readings fall outside specification and the entire bottom end must be disassembled again.

Material Construction and Load Handling

The main bearings use a multi-layered copper-lead alloy bonded to a steel backing. This construction allows the softer bearing surface to conform to minor journal imperfections while the steel backing resists crushing under peak cylinder pressures. The connecting rod bearings employ high-strength steel backings to resist deformation during the high-torque strokes typical of V2003 and V2203 applications in skid steers and generators. The thrust washer carries an anti-friction coating on its working faces to manage the axial loads generated by the crankshaft gear train and accessory drives.

The Hidden Cost of Grade Mismatch

Fitting standard-size bearings onto a 0.25-undersize crankshaft journal produces oil clearances far beyond design limits. The result is not a slow degradation but an immediate, audible knock within minutes of startup, followed by spun bearings and scored journals that demand a replacement crankshaft rather than a simple regrind [NEED_CITE: consequences of excessive bearing clearance in diesel engines]. The labour cost of a second teardown, combined with the scrap value of a damaged crankshaft, turns a routine bearing replacement into a major financial loss that could have been avoided by confirming the journal grade first.

Installation & Rebuild Sequence

  • Measure all main and rod journals with a micrometer before selecting STD, 0.25, or 0.50 undersize bearings.
  • Clean all oil galleries and crankshaft drillings to prevent debris from entering the new bearing surfaces.
  • Install main bearing shells dry, checking that locating tangs seat correctly in the block saddles.
  • Use plastigauge to verify oil clearance on every journal before final torque of main caps and rod caps.
  • Check crankshaft end-play with a dial indicator after installing the thrust washer to confirm it falls within specification.
  • Prime the lubrication system and verify oil pressure at idle before applying load during the initial run-in period.

Q: How do I determine whether I need STD, 0.25, or 0.50 undersize bearings? A: Measure the crankshaft main and rod journals with a micrometer and compare the readings against Kubota's published journal diameter specifications. A journal that has been reground previously will measure smaller than the standard dimension. Providing these measurements allows the correct undersize grade to be selected and shipped, preventing clearance mismatch after assembly.

Q: What system-level fault should I diagnose before replacing bearings to prevent repeat failure? A: Bearing failure often originates from oil starvation caused by a failing oil pump, clogged filter, or blocked oil gallery rather than bearing age alone. Investigate oil pressure history, inspect the oil pump and relief valve, and flush all lubrication passages before installing new bearings. Addressing the root cause prevents the new bearing set from suffering the same premature failure within the first operating hours.
